As the sacred festival of Chhath Puja approaches in October 2025, educational authorities across Delhi-NCR have announced holiday declarations for schools in key regions. The annual celebration, dedicated to worshipping the Sun God, will see temporary closures of educational institutions to allow families to observe traditional rituals.
Official Holiday Declarations for Delhi-NCR
District administrations in Noida, Ghaziabad, and surrounding areas have confirmed that schools will remain closed during Chhath Puja celebrations. Cyclone Montha Disrupts Academic Schedules in Southern States
Meanwhile, educational institutions in coastal regions of Andhra Pradesh, Odisha, and Chennai are facing unexpected closures due to Cyclone Montha. The severe weather system has prompted precautionary measures, including temporary shutdowns of schools and colleges to ensure student safety.
State governments have activated emergency protocols, with education departments closely monitoring the situation. The cyclone's impact has necessitated rescheduling of academic activities and examinations in affected regions, with authorities prioritizing the well-being of students and staff.
